There being no further speakers, the Chairman closed the Public Hearing. <br />MOTION WAS MADE by Commissioner Wheeler, <br />SECONDED by Vice Chairman Solari, to approve SR60 <br />Vero LLC's rezoning request. <br />Commissioner Wheeler affirmed that this was an excellent location in which to have <br />some multi -family units and student rentals, and a good location for people who do not have <br />cars, or who prefer to walk to and from the nearby commercial areas. <br />The Chairman CALLED THE QUESTION, and the <br />Motion carried unanimously. the Board adopted <br />Ordinance 2009-022, amending the Zoning Ordinance <br />and the accompanying zoning map for ± 19.98 acres <br />located south of S.R. 60 and approximately 1350 feet west <br />of 58th Avenue from RM -6, Multi -Family Residential <br />District (up to 6 units/acre) to RM -8, Multi -Family <br />Residential District (up to 8 units/acre); and providing <br />codification, severability, and effective date. <br />10.A.2.
